KAEF is a television station in Eureka, California (licensed to Arcata}. The station runs programming from the ABC network. KAEF is a full-power television station that operates with 141 kw of power and is owned by Bluestone Television.

KAEF began broadcasting on August 1, 1987 as KREQ-TV. Before, ABC programming was carried in part by stations KVIQ and KIEM in addition to their primary affiliations with NBC and CBS, respectively. In addition, local cable systems offered Redding ABC affiliate KRCR-TV on cable.

KAEF-TV currently does not offer local newscasts, just a 5 minute weather report at 11pm before Extra. The only programs of its own are Friends, Extra, Cristina's Court, and Judge Alex; all other programming is controlled by KRCR-TV.
